There is a new school opening on Amelia Island in August. At the corner of Gum and 8th Street in Fernandina Beach, Florida, The Learning Community of North Florida will be offering small classes on topics such as Making Money on E-Bay, Learning Culinary Arts, Scrap Booking and much more.
Educating people is traditionally a long, hard process and not a great way to earn a living. Selling students on a one time session that is packed full of content gives us an educational option to fulfill our desire for instant gratification at an affordable price.
Nancy Rossiter is the President of TLCNF. She taught on the college level for eleven years, most recently as an Assistant Professor of Entrepreneurship at Jacksonville University. Nancy has authored two published textbooks and many articles on entrepreneurship, marketing, and leadership.
Their grand opening is on August 1, 2009 from 11:00 AM until 2:00 PM, stop by 626 South 8th Street and they will be happy to answer your questions.
